Trump’s Key DC Prosecutor Frequently Appears on Russian State Television

President Donald Trump’s choice for Washington’s U.S. attorney position has been featured more than 150 times on Russian state media, as revealed by an investigation conducted by

The Washington Post.

Ed Martin didn’t originally reveal his TV appearances between 2016 and 2024 when questioned by the Senate, according to reports from the newspaper. Before his confirmation hearing with the Senate Judiciary Committee, he was required to complete a detailed questionnaire listing all media interview engagements. As the current acting U.S. attorney for Washington, Martin failed to admit that he had participated as a guest commentator on what were described as propaganda networks multiple times over those years. During this period, he made more frequent appearances on these channels compared to any other significant cable news platform. The State Department notes that RT operates beyond typical journalism; it has been involved in information campaigns, clandestine manipulation efforts, and even arms deals. Recently, a coalition of senior government figures such as attorneys and ex-politicians wrote to the D.C. Court of Appeals requesting an inquiry into Ed Martin’s actions.
